Paver Driveway Sealing in Kitsap County, WA
Paver driveway sealing is a service that involves applying a protective coating to paver surfaces to enhance their appearance and durability. This process helps to prevent damage from weather, stains, and wear, making it suitable for various projects such as residential driveways, walkways, patios, and other paved areas around the property. Homeowners often request this service to maintain the aesthetic appeal of their paver installations, extend their lifespan, and reduce the need for future repairs.
Before requesting paver sealing, property owners typically want to understand the condition of their existing pavers, including whether they need cleaning or repairs prior to sealing. It's also common to inquire about the types of sealants used, the expected appearance after sealing, and how often the service should be repeated to keep the pavers protected. Proper preparation and choosing the right sealing product are key factors in achieving a long-lasting, attractive finish.

Enhanced Durability
Sealing paver driveways helps protect against cracks, stains, and wear caused by daily use.
Improved Appearance
A fresh sealant enhances the color and texture of pavers, boosting curb appeal for homes in kitsap county.
Maintenance Protection
Proper sealing reduces weed growth and prevents damage from moisture and freeze-thaw cycles on driveways.

Paver Driveway Sealing Questions
What is paver driveway sealing? It is a protective coating applied to paver driveways to enhance durability and appearance.
Why should property owners consider sealing pavers? Sealing helps prevent stains, reduces weed growth, and extends the lifespan of the driveway.
What types of pavers benefit from sealing? Most common pavers, including concrete, brick, and stone, can benefit from sealing to improve their look and protection.
When is the best time to seal a paver driveway? Sealing is best done when the driveway is clean and dry, typically in mild weather conditions to ensure proper adhesion.
